London Voilence



Violence erupted in broad daylight this
afternoon as rioters surrounded police vans,
looted lorries and targeted shops in a series of
attacks across London.
Scores of police raced to Hackney as a mob of
hooded youths began hurling missiles at the
officers. There was also sporadic violence in
nearby Dalston where shops and businesses
were attacked and youths clashed with police
and set fire to cars outside Lewisham Town
Hall.
In Peckham Rye shops have been attacked,
including Clarks and Primark, and buses are not
currently running through Peckham and
Lewisham. Other areas of London were braced
for violence with workers barricading their
shops in Stratford and Islington and barriers
were erected outside Westfield Shopping
Centre.
Kilburn High Street has also been closed off
and police are currently on the streets in
Harlesden.
On Twitter, users posted that the violence was
rapidly brimming out of control with one person
tweeting he had seen 'at least 30 riot vans and
three helicopters' in Hackney. Youths were
seen setting fire to cars, rubbish bins, and
were also spotted setting off fireworks in the
direction of police.
